AH : Print work ideas


After reviewing the album cover for Mikill pane I believe that our print work should incorporate a similar format, using a minimalist style of print work. Mikill pane uses a single image in this case which is an idea we hope to emulate in our print work. The use of extra dietetic gaze is apparent through the artist looking directly at the camera which is also something we will consider when producing our print work.












Furthermore the use of the logo, in which this case is chalked into the floor is a feature which is going to be evident within ours, as it helps to distinguish the artist from others through his own unique logo.

In this case Mikill pane uses aspects such as mise en scene in terms of the location and props in order to reflect the notion of him being a 'school boy' through the use of his costume (uniform) as well as the location which appears to be a play ground. This helps to show the characteristics of Mikill Pane, due to the fact that he would consider himself to appeal to a younger generation, and he is a fairly comical character in terms of the content he uses within music videos, however, within music videos he presents himself using serious facial expressions. Therefore we are given two sides to the artist which we can connote through his costume in this case, where he is wearing a formal school uniform with his tie and top button done up, however his lower half of his body, he is wearing trainers and socks to help to juxtapose this formal and informal fashion.
